Eminem's "Music To Be Murdered By - Side B" is a gripping continuation of his eleventh studio album, released on December 18, 2020. This deluxe edition expands the original project with 16 new tracks, bringing the total to 36 songs and clocking in at nearly two hours of intense, genre-blending hip hop. The album showcases Eminem's signature lyrical prowess and versatility, with collaborations from a diverse range of artists including Skylar Grey, Dr. Dre, Ed Sheeran, Juice WRLD, and many more.
The album delves into various sub-genres of hip hop, from horrorcore to pop-rap and comedy rap, demonstrating Eminem's ability to adapt and innovate. Tracks like "Godzilla" featuring Juice WRLD and "Those Kinda Nights" with Ed Sheeran highlight his range, while songs like "Killer" and "Tone Deaf" showcase his raw, unfiltered style. The album also features skits and interludes that add a cinematic quality, enhancing the overall listening experience.

Eminem, born Marshall Bruce Mathers III, is a titan of hip-hop, renowned for his lyrical prowess and controversial yet influential presence in the music industry. Hailing from St. Joseph, Missouri, Eminem rose to fame in the late 1990s and early 2000s, breaking down racial barriers and popularizing hip-hop in Middle America. His alter ego, Slim Shady, allowed him to explore transgressive themes, making him a controversial yet iconic figure. With a career spanning over two decades, Eminem has achieved unprecedented success, becoming the first artist to have ten consecutive albums debut at number one on the Billboard chart. Beyond his solo career, he is also a member of the group D12 and the hip-hop duo Bad Meets Evil. His discography includes timeless hits like "Lose Yourself" and "Love the Way You Lie," and his impact on the genre is undeniable.
